What is the central theme of Pygmalion?

AColonialism

BClass and social mobility

CWar and peace

DRomantic love

Answer:

B. Class and social mobility

Read Explanation:

The play explores how speech and manners can determine a person's social position, highlighting class divisions and possibilities for transformation.
